Is 100 pesos a good tip?
For a day-tour, or one that only lasts a few hours, it is appropriate to tip your guide
10 percent to 20 percent of the total cost
of the tour. For multi-day group tours, tip the tour leader a minimum of 60 to 100 pesos per day. ... If you have a driver in addition to a tour guide, you should tip them 40 pesos per day.

Is 50 pesos a good tip?
Hotel. The Bellhop:
25 – 50 pesos is a standard tip
for helping you to your room and with your luggage. The Concierge: Tipping 50 to 150 pesos for helpful recommendations is always appreciated. Housekeeping: A tip of 25 to 50 pesos a day for keeping your room tidy is appropriate.
